Cancellation Policy
Cancel Before the Free Trial Ends
To avoid the first subscription charge, the customer must complete cancellation before the trial expiry date shown during checkout and in Subscription Management. No subscription fee is charged for the eligible free trial when cancellation is completed on time.
How to Cancel
Customers may cancel through the available Paddle billing portal or Orvix subscription-management page. When self-service cancellation is temporarily unavailable, the customer may contact Orvix support using the verified billing email. Cancellation is complete only when a confirmation appears or is sent.
Cancellation After a Charge
Unless the subscription is terminated immediately for misuse, security reasons or non-payment, cancellation normally stops the next renewal and access continues until the end of the current paid billing period. A cancellation after collection does not automatically create a refund for the current period.
Downgrades and Add-ons
A downgrade or add-on removal may take effect at the next billing cycle and may reduce limits, storage, AI credits, BI access, support, portal branding or other entitlements. Customers are responsible for bringing usage within the new limits before the change becomes effective.
Data Before Access Ends
Customers should export required data before access ends. Retention and deletion remain subject to the Privacy Policy, Data Processing Agreement and any written enterprise terms.
